I walked up on two huge buck scrapes on state land a few days ago. I had my game cart and I was taking my bear bait deep in the woods.
The wet leaves were matted down around both scrapes from the early morning frost. You could see large hoof prints in the scrape that kicked dirt outside on top of the leaves two feet away.
These scrapes were deep inside the ground then other scrapes in spotted earlier. One scrape had an over hanging tree limb the size of a one inch pipe broken in half.
